Meaning

to scrape away
Extended definition

(μάσσω, Att... -ττω, to touch, handle), [in LXX: Tob.7:17 * ;] to wipe off, wire clean: mid., Luk.10:11.

Source: STEPBible TBESG + Abbott-Smith
